Food with Eggs at 10 months???
« on: October 19, 2007, 16:21:09 pm »
Good morning!

Mary is 10 months old.. I was thinking about making some whole grain pancakes to have as finger food.. but they are made with eggs.. is that ok for her at this age?  Worried about increasing her likelihood of egg allergy..??

If you want to avoid eggs, you can easily make pancakes with the yolk only, or substitute 2 T. tapioca flour or arrowroot starch and about 1/3 c. of water for the egg.
